Transaction 18e62b95cab35fe44716aa176931b97d1b436396a26ccc85b953a60fd9b7a063

1 Input
2 Outputs
  • 18e62b95cab35fe44716aa176931b97d1b436396a26ccc85b953a60fd9b7a063:0
  • value  22233718
    address  35K2HwU7qDp9rrwSvghvKPWL8CmTeLVHcz
  • 18e62b95cab35fe44716aa176931b97d1b436396a26ccc85b953a60fd9b7a063:1
  • value  47725601
    address  bc1q9h2xsqqdrftvwgrxhud6nq2x4su9g37rpa03ud